阿里云的服务器(ECS实例)本身默认提供的是无图形界面的命令行操作系统镜像,但你可以根据需要选择安装带有图形化界面的操作系统,或者在已有系统上自行安装图形界面。以下是相关说明:
一、阿里云官方提供的带图形化界面的系统镜像
阿里云官方在镜像市场中提供了一些预装图形化桌面的镜像,主要包括:
1. Windows 系统(自带图形界面)
- 所有 Windows 版本的 ECS 镜像均自带图形化桌面环境,例如:
- Windows Server 2022
- Windows Server 2019
- Windows Server 2016
- 可通过 远程桌面连接(RDP) 直接登录图形界面。
- 适合运行 .NET 应用、IIS、SQL Server 等。
✅ 推荐:如果你需要开箱即用的图形界面,建议选择 Windows Server 系统。
2. 部分第三方或自定义 Linux 图形化镜像(通过镜像市场)
阿里云的「镜像市场」中有一些第三方厂商提供的预装图形界面的 Linux 镜像,例如:
- Ubuntu Desktop 版(如 Ubuntu 20.04/22.04 Desktop)
- CentOS 带 GNOME 桌面的定制镜像
- 其他含 KDE、XFCE 等桌面环境的镜像
⚠️ 注意:这些镜像非阿里云官方出品,需额外付费或由第三方提供,使用前请确认安全性和兼容性。
二、手动在 Linux 系统上安装图形界面
你也可以在标准的 Linux 系统(如 CentOS、Ubuntu Server)上自行安装图形化桌面,例如:
1. Ubuntu Server + 安装 GNOME / XFCE
# 安装 GNOME 桌面
sudo apt update
sudo apt install ubuntu-desktop
# 或安装轻量级 XFCE
sudo apt install xfce4 xfce4-goodies
2. CentOS / Alibaba Cloud Linux + 安装 GNOME
# 安装 GNOME 桌面环境
sudo yum groupinstall "GNOME Desktop" -y
# 设置启动图形界面
sudo systemctl set-default graphical.target
sudo systemctl start gdm
🔐 安全提示:生产环境中不推荐开启图形界面,会增加资源消耗和安全风险。
三、如何访问图形界面?
-
Windows 实例:
- 使用 Windows 自带的「远程桌面连接(mstsc)」工具连接公网 IP。
- 需配置安全组放行 3389 端口。
-
Linux 图形界面实例:
- 安装并配置 VNC Server 或 xRDP。
- 通过 VNC 客户端(如 TigerVNC、RealVNC)或 RDP 连接。
- 示例(Ubuntu + VNC):
sudo apt install tightvncserver vncserver :1 - 安全组需放行 VNC 端口(如 5901)。
四、总结:哪些系统有图形界面?
| 系统类型 | 是否自带图形界面 | 访问方式 |
|---|---|---|
| Windows Server | ✅ 是 | 远程桌面(RDP) |
| Ubuntu Desktop 镜像(镜像市场) | ✅ 是 | VNC / RDP |
| CentOS 带桌面镜像(第三方) | ✅ 是 | VNC |
| 标准 Linux(Ubuntu/CentOS Server) | ❌ 否(可手动安装) | 安装后通过 VNC/xRDP 访问 |
✅ 建议使用场景:
- 日常运维、开发测试:推荐使用 Windows Server 或 Ubuntu Desktop 镜像。
- 生产环境:建议使用命令行,更安全、高效。
- 学习 Linux 桌面:可用 VNC 搭配轻量桌面(如 XFCE)。
如需查找图形化镜像,可登录 阿里云 ECS 控制台 → 镜像市场,搜索关键词如“Ubuntu 桌面”、“Desktop”等。
如有具体需求(如想搭建图形化开发环境),可进一步提供场景,我可以给出详细配置方案。
ECLOUD博客